UK signs Comprehensive and Progressive Agreement for Trans-Pacific Partnership - CPTPP

Minister Mary Ng's participation in the signing ceremony, acknowledging the UK's accession to the CPTPP, underscores Canada's steadfast support for the United Kingdom and our shared commitment to free and fair trade principles.


The British Canadian Chamber of Trade and Commerce wholeheartedly applauds the Government of Canada's spirit of amity, fortified by an extensive network of British Chambers within the CPTPP region; we resolutely reaffirm our commitment to providing unwavering assistance to British and Canadianbusinesses seeking to expand their presence in the region. We stand ready to offer invaluable guidance, expertise, and robust infrastructure to facilitate their ventures.


With eager anticipation, we look forward to the continued development and consolidation of our economic partnerships. As eloquently articulated by UK Foreign Secretary James Cleverly during his visit to Toronto in January, “Canada and the UK: we’re family.”
